Blackjack is a game of skill and strategy, where players must make decisions on when to hit, stand, double down, or split their cards. The house edge in blackjack can vary depending on the rules of the game, such as the number of decks used, the dealer’s hitting and standing rules, and the payout for blackjack. Generally, the house edge in blackjack ranges from 0.5% to 1%, making it one of the most favorable games for players in online casinos.

Roulette, on the other hand, is a game of chance where players bet on where a ball will land on a spinning wheel. The house edge in roulette is determined by the number of pockets on the wheel and the type of bets that players can make. In European roulette, which has 37 pockets including one zero, the house edge is 2.7%. In American roulette, which has 38 pockets including two zeros, the house edge is 5.26%.

When comparing the house edge across different versions of blackjack and roulette, it is clear that blackjack offers better odds for players than roulette. However, within each game, there are variations that can affect the house edge. For example, in blackjack, games with fewer decks and favorable rules for players, such as the ability to surrender or double after splitting, can lower the house edge. In roulette, playing European instead of American roulette can reduce the house edge by half.
